Question: Solve the given problems.
An analysis of samples of air for a city showed that the number of parts per million of sulfur dioxide on a certain day was p = 0.05 ln(2 + 24t - t2), where is the hour of the day. Using differentials, find the approximate change in the amount of sulfur dioxide between 10 A.M. and noon.
